Tasting Notes
This sake is fashioned from Omachi rice; a strain that first emerged in the Okayama Prefecture more than 160 years ago and produces sakes of notable depth and complexity. The yeast used in the fermentation is called pink nadeshiko. Taken from the dianthus flower, it imparts a highly aromatic, floral character. This smooth, balanced, eminently enjoyable sake has fine acidity.
